Harvest Healthcare Leaders Income ETF (HHL.TO) is an exchange-traded fund focused on generating income through investments in healthcare companies, primarily in North America. The ETF's unique competitive advantage lies in its targeted exposure to high-quality healthcare firms, which are often less sensitive to economic cycles, providing a defensive investment profile.
HHL.TO generates income primarily through dividend distributions from its portfolio of healthcare stocks, which includes large-cap pharmaceutical and biotechnology firms. The ETF benefits from the stability of the healthcare sector, which tends to exhibit lower volatility and consistent demand, providing a reliable income stream.
